The cheapest way to get from Waltham Cross to Brent Cross is to bus and line 102 bus which costs £1 - £3 and takes 1h 52m.
The fastest way to get from Waltham Cross to Brent Cross is to taxi which takes 21 min and costs £170 - £210.
No, there is no direct bus from Waltham Cross station to Brent Cross station. However, there are services departing from Bus Station and arriving at Brent Cross Station via Finsbury Park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 30m.
No, there is no direct train from Waltham Cross to Brent Cross station. However, there are services departing from Waltham Cross and arriving at Brent Cross station via Tottenham Hale Station and Euston station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 46 min.
The distance between Waltham Cross and Brent Cross is 18 miles. The road distance is 13.1 miles.
The best way to get from Waltham Cross to Brent Cross without a car is to train and subway which takes 46 min and costs £12 - £45.
It takes approximately 46 min to get from Waltham Cross to Brent Cross, including transfers.
